Latest Patents

Nakamura's recent patents highlight his expertise in creating advanced mechanical systems. One of his notable inventions is the "Vehicle Stabilizer and Method of Manufacturing the Same," which features a stabilizer equipped with a restriction ring connected to a torsion portion. The design incorporates a unique body structure that includes both male and female portions, ensuring enhanced stability through intricate engineering.

Another significant patent is the "Coil Spring Modeling Apparatus and Method Utilizing a Torsion Detection to Control an Actuator Unit." This advanced apparatus involves a complex mechanism that integrates a Stewart-platform-type parallel mechanism and hydraulic pressure supply, alongside a torsion detection mechanism using displacement gauges. This innovative system allows for precision in controlling torsional angles, marking a leap forward in spring modeling technology.

Career Highlights

Takahiro Nakamura's career includes pivotal roles at notable companies such as NHK Spring Co., Ltd. and NHK International Corporation. His work in these organizations has provided him with a platform to innovate and develop cutting-edge products that cater to modern engineering needs.
